Trump and Xi Discuss Trade Truce Amid Tensions

Story summary
  • U.S. President Donald Trump and China's President Xi Jinping held constructive talks.
  • Trump signaled tariffs could follow if China resumes soybean purchases and fentanyl exports.
  • The trade truce expires November 10, 2025, risking possible escalations.
  • China aims to reduce reliance on foreign technology and boost domestic demand.
  • Despite sluggish domestic demand, China seeks manufacturing dominance and advancement of high-tech industries.
